., AstraZeneca Plc and Eli Lilly & Co., to reveal how they treat whistleblowers who file complaints under the False Claims Act.Grassley, an Iowa Republican, sent letters June 28 that posed eight questions such as how companies notify employees of the law, how they treat whistleblowers and what changes they have made in response to a 2009 law extending anti-retaliation protections. Image via WikipediaThe FDA launched probes into possible risks from an Eli Lilly and Co (LLY.N) bloodthinner, a Sanofi-Aventis heart drug and other medicines.The FDA released its quarterly list of early investigations into health problems reported with various drugs on Wednesday.On the list, the agency said it was probing cases of thrombotic thrombocytopenic purpura (TTP) in patients treated with Effient, a blood thinner from Lilly and Daiichi Sankyo.
